#ea1c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ea1c56 is composed of 91.8% red, 11%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 343.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#ea1c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ac with #d50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#ea1c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ea1c56 has RGB values of R:234, G:28,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.63,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15342678.

Shades and Tints of #ea1c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060102 is the darkest color, while #fef3f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ea1c56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7b80 is the less saturated color, while #fd094e is the most saturated one.
